TNPSC Group 1 Answer Key 2025

TNPSC Answer Key 2025: The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ission (TNPSC) has officially released the OMR Answer Sheet for the Combined Civil Services (Preliminary) Examination-I Group I Services (Notification No. 16/2022) today, June 5, 2025. Candidates who appeared for the examination can now access and download their answer sheets directly from the official TNPSC website, tnpsc.gov.in.

The Group I Services exam is a highly competitive recruitment drive for administrative posts within the Tamil Nadu state government. With the release of the answer key, candidates can assess their performance in the preliminary examination.

How to download TNPSC Group 1 OMR Answer Sheet?

Candidates can easily download their OMR Answer Sheet by following these simple steps:

Step 1. Go to the official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ission website: www.tnpsc.gov.in.
Step 2. On the homepage, locate and click on the "Results" tab, usually found in the right-hand corner or within the "Recruitment" section.
Step 3. From the dropdown menu under "Results," choose "Answer Keys."
Step 4. Look for the link related to the "Combined Civil Services (Preliminary) Examination-I Group I Services 2025" answer key.
Step 5. Click on the relevant link to view and download your OMR Answer Sheet. It will typically be available in PDF format.
Step 6. Download the PDF and save it for your reference. Candidates are advised to carefully compare their marked responses with the official answer key to estimate their scores.

The release of the OMR Answer Sheet allows candidates to get an early estimate of their scores. It's important to note that this is often a provisional answer key, and the TNPSC may provide a window for candidates to raise objections against any discrepancies they find. The final answer key, which forms the basis for result calculation, is typically released after considering all valid objections.

Candidates should keep a close eye on the official TNPSC website for further updates regarding the objection submission process (if applicable) and the announcement of preliminary exam results. Qualifying in the preliminary examination is the first hurdle towards appearing for the TNPSC Group 1 Mains examination, followed by an interview for final selection.
